About this bottle

Bourbon Spring is named after a spring just a short walk from the Quincy Street Distillery where the Cook Count Militia was founded in 1834 and celebration involving bourbon ensued. The whiskey is distilled from a mash bill of 83% corn, 9% barley malt, and 8% rye malt. It's bottled at 44% abv after aging for 3 to 5 months in small (5-15 gallon) barrels.

COKEEFE3 5.0

This 'baby' bourbon kicks like a mule, in all the right ways. Absolutely fantastic input for any cocktail needing a lil' help from the Whiskey section. With smokey notes that fade into a smooth caramel, this is fantastic for any cocktails that aren't afraid of whiskey notes that enhance, rather than overpower.

Victoria Fitzsimmons

This is different than any bourbon I have ever tasted. I love the bold flavors of oak and caramel. This bourbon would be terrific in an Old Fashioned.

Whiskey Dabbler 5.0

Best of the young whiskeys the midwest is putting out. A little smokey from the barrel and a lot of vanilla.
